我是jQuery的新手,但我已經對它的力量印象深刻。我的問題是:jquery if else語句hasClass addClass點擊
我想
- 添加
class='dec'
到#jf1
當我點擊它,如果它有class='undec'
- 添加
class='undec'
到#jf1
當我點擊它,如果它有class='dec'
這是我的 - 它不工作!
<script>
$(document).ready(function(){
$(function() {
$('#jf1').click(function() {
if ('#jf1'.hasClass("undec")) {
$('#jf1').toggleClass("undec dec");
}
else if ('#jf1'.hasClass("dec")) {
$('#jf1').toggleClass("dec undec";
}
});
});
});
</script>
爲什麼您使用的$(document)和$(功能)兩者一起後,再次需要的功能? – 2013-02-26 08:12:06